Doeren Mayhew is a $170 million certified public accounting and advisory firm headquartered in Troy, Michigan, with offices in Grand Rapids, Saranac, Houston, Miami, Atlanta, Dallas, Charlotte, Tampa, Zurich and London. Founded in 1932, Doeren Mayhew is recognized as one of the Top 55 largest CPA firms in the U.S. If you want to join a company positioned for successful future growth and is consistently named among the 50 best-managed firms in the nation, this is the place for you!
Our Payroll Services Group provides payroll services to an array of private clients, including those in the agriculture & food, construction, retail, non-profit, manufacturing, health care, and restaurant industries.
The Payroll Services Group continues to grow, and we’re looking to add an entry- to mid-level skilled Payroll Specialist to our team. This role is crucial for our future growth and will play a key part in ensuring our payroll processes are efficient and accurate.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in payroll management and a passion for delivering exceptional service.
This full-time role will be on site in our Grand Rapids, MI, office on Mon/Tues/Wed, and remote on Thurs/Fri each week.

Primary Responsibilities:
- Process weekly, biweekly, or semimonthly client payrolls in accordance with our clients’ time entry data and regulatory requirements. Maintain client lists, schedules, and calendars for routine payroll processing, year-end adjustments, and holiday schedules.
- Administer paychecks by importing hours from time and production records, determine earnings by calculating gross pay, required withholdings, deductions, and net pay using established procedures developed in coordination with company policies, regulatory, and payroll system provider requirements.
- Create and distribute payroll reports to various clients electronically. Create customized reports unique to each client’s needs.
- Set up direct deposit, withholdings, and/or deductions.
- Ensure the appropriate new hire paperwork is processed and verified in a timely manner to meet the client processing schedule.
- Validate new hire data integrity and process payroll entries for bonuses, commissions, relocations, stock options, and year-end adjustments as required.
- Prepare general ledger reports and entries to be submitted to clients and communicate payroll data as required.
- Learn and become an advanced user of the Asure software. Train clients in the proper use of the software.
- Associate’s degree or equivalent experience.
- Two to four years of payroll processing experience is ideal, preferably at a payroll processing firm.
- Knowledge of the Asure software or technical ability to become proficient quickly.
- Ability to provide excellent service over the phone by troubleshooting user issues and recommending solutions to improve the client’s situation. Ability to handle a wide variety of calls, regular interruptions, and deadlines with confidence and ease.
- Strong data entry, attention to detail, and organizational skills with the ability to multi-task and prioritize projects to ensure timely completion.
- Strong math skills and accuracy with numbers and calculations.
- Competency in professional writing and communication.
- Establish and maintain a positive working relationship with clients and coworkers to promote a positive quality service image.
- Ability to operate various types of technology and software applications. Competent user of MS Office, especially Word, Excel, and Outlook.
